Yes, weather-rated and corrosion-resistant materials are considered necessary for coastal electrical installations to ensure long-term safety, reliability, and durability in harsh marine environments.
Salt-laden air and high humidity in coastal areas accelerate the degradation of standard electrical components significantly faster than in inland locations. Utilizing weather-rated materials provides several critical protections:
- Corrosion Resistance: Components engineered for marine environments—such as those made from stainless steel, marine-grade aluminum, or coated copper—withstand salt exposure much longer than standard steel enclosures.
- Protective Enclosures: Using NEMA 4X rated enclosures provides a sealed barrier that prevents water ingress and protects vulnerable internal wiring from corrosive salt particles.
- Enhanced Safety: Weather-rated materials and corrosion-resistant breakers are designed to shield internal mechanisms from moisture, which reduces the risk of arc faults, ground faults, and potential fire hazards.
- Cost Efficiency: While the initial investment is higher, using these materials can reduce long-term maintenance costs by 30 to 50 percent by preventing frequent breakdowns and extending the system’s lifespan by 10 to 15 years.
- System Performance: Specialized materials like anti-corrosion terminals and bus bars maintain stable connections, preventing voltage drops and flickering lights often caused by the buildup of salt air electrical corrosion.
